Mingus Ah Um, Charles Mingus
Released in 1959, Mingus Ah Um is the definitive statement from one of jazz's most visionary and uncompromising artists. Charles Mingus — composer, bassist, and bandleader of extraordinary depth — assembled a remarkable ensemble and delivered an album that stretches across the full breadth of jazz history, from blues and gospel roots to hard bop and beyond. Tracks like Better Git It in Your Soul pulse with raw church energy, while Goodbye Pork Pie Hat — a hauntingly beautiful elegy for Lester Young — remains one of the most emotionally devastating compositions in the entire jazz canon.
Where many of his contemporaries were pushing jazz forward in a single direction, Mingus was doing something more ambitious: synthesizing the whole of the music's tradition into something entirely his own. The album is bold, sprawling, and deeply personal.
